Paul McAuley has certainly been ranting a bit lately but in a well reasoned passionate kind of way. Have a look at this on the not very healthy state of affairs in sf at the moment. Given that writers are leaving the genre I can see his point - I note that with his latest book, Greg Bear has well and truly joined the list of authors moving into thriller/crime stories.

This from the end of McAuley's piece is rather nice though in a rabble rousing kind of way:
So if you’re a writer, write from the heart as well as from the mind. Aim for an audience if you like, but know this: at best you’re going to hit nothing more than a temporary, here-and-gone demographic. Wouldn’t it be better to try to write the book that means more to you than any other book? You’ll probably fail. But you can always try again, and fail better. And, dear reader: buy books. Tell people about the books you like. Spread the word. Behave like you have found the best and finest secret in the world. And who knows? Perhaps you have.
